Global Metallized Film Market (USD Million), 2021 - 2031
In the year 2024, the Global Metallized Film Market was valued at USD 4,607.23 million. The size of this market is expected to increase to USD 6,379.82 million by the year 2031, while growing at a Compounded Annual Growth Rate (CAGR) of 4.8%.
The Global Metallized Film Market stands as a pivotal sector within the broader landscape of packaging materials and industrial applications. Metallized films, comprised of a thin layer of metal deposited onto a polymer substrate, are engineered to offer a myriad of benefits across numerous industries. Through vacuum metallization processes, these films acquire properties such as enhanced barrier performance, opacity, and visual appeal. Their versatility renders them indispensable in various sectors, spanning from food and beverage packaging to pharmaceuticals, electronics, and insulation. Metallized films serve as a linchpin in applications necessitating moisture resistance, oxygen barrier capabilities, and decorative finishes, thus contributing significantly to the global packaging and industrial landscape.

Global Metallized Film Market Recent Developments
-
In September 2020, Cosmo Films unveiled a groundbreaking transparent thermal lamination antimicrobial film crafted from BOPP (Biaxially Oriented Polypropylene). This innovative film tackles the global challenge of bacterial contamination on packaged products through a novel antimicrobial technique. Designed to prevent microbial growth on surfaces, the film efficiently combats a wide spectrum of germs while inhibiting their development, thereby promoting enhanced hygiene standards across various industries.
-
In February 2020, Jindal Poly Films' board of directors greenlit a significant expansion plan involving an investment of Rs 700 crore. This investment is earmarked for bolstering Polyester Film Line-I and BOPP Film Line-9, reflecting the company's commitment to advancing its production capabilities and meeting the growing demand for high-quality packaging solutions.
-
In September 2018, FlexFilms, the global film manufacturing arm of Uflex, introduced two cutting-edge BOPET films. Among them is FLEXMETPROTECT™ F-HBP-M, an aluminum alternative metallized high-barrier BOPET film, engineered to provide superior barrier properties. Additionally, FLEXPET™ F-HPF, another product from FlexFilms, is a puncture-resistant BOPET film designed as a replacement for nylon. These advancements underscore FlexFilms' dedication to innovation and meeting evolving market needs with state-of-the-art packaging solutions.

Global Metallized Film Market, Segmentation by Base Metal
The Global Metallized Film Market has been segmented by Base Metal into Aluminum, Copper, Nickel, Chromium and Others.
This segmentation distinguishes metallized films according to the type of metal deposited onto the polymer substrate, offering insights into the diverse range of options available to manufacturers and end-users. Aluminum, as one of the primary base metals, holds significant prominence in the market. Aluminum metallized films are renowned for their exceptional barrier properties against moisture, oxygen, and light, making them a preferred choice for flexible packaging applications across various industries. The versatility and reliability of aluminum metallized films have cemented their position as a staple material in the packaging industry, ensuring product protection, shelf life extension, and brand visibility.
Additionally, copper emerges as another key base metal segment within the Global Metallized Film Market. Copper metallized films cater to specialized applications requiring superior electrical conductivity and thermal stability. These films find extensive usage in electronic components, conductive tapes, and printed circuit boards, where copper's conductivity properties are paramount. Copper metallized films play a crucial role in enhancing the performance and functionality of electronic devices, ensuring reliable connectivity and signal transmission. Moreover, nickel, chromium, and other base metals contribute to the market diversity, offering specialized properties and applications in niche industries.
Global Metallized Film Market, Segmentation by Type
The Global Metallized Film Market has been segmented by Type into Metallized Polypropylene (PP), Metallized Polyethylene Terephthalate (PET), Metallized Polyethylene (PE) and Others.
Metallized Polypropylene (PP) films. Metallized PP films are widely utilized in packaging applications due to their excellent moisture barrier properties, high tensile strength, and heat sealability. These films offer exceptional clarity and gloss, making them suitable for applications where product visibility and aesthetics are crucial, such as food packaging, labels, and decorative laminates. Metallized PP films are valued for their versatility, cost-effectiveness, and compatibility with printing and converting processes, enabling manufacturers to achieve premium packaging solutions that meet consumer demands for convenience and visual appeal.
Another significant segment in the Global Metallized Film Market is Metallized Polyethylene Terephthalate (PET) films. Metallized PET films are renowned for their superior mechanical properties, thermal stability, and dimensional stability, making them ideal for a wide range of packaging and industrial applications. These films offer excellent barrier properties against moisture, oxygen, and aroma transmission, ensuring product freshness and shelf life extension. Metallized PET films are commonly used in flexible packaging, lamination, insulation, and label applications across industries such as food and beverage, pharmaceuticals, and electronics. The versatility and reliability of metallized PET films make them a preferred choice for manufacturers seeking high-performance packaging solutions that enhance product protection, brand differentiation, and sustainability.
Additionally, Metallized Polyethylene (PE) films and other specialized types contribute to the diversity of the Global Metallized Film Market, offering unique properties and applications in niche industries. Metallized PE films are valued for their flexibility, moisture resistance, and sealability, making them suitable for applications requiring barrier properties and durability, such as food packaging, agricultural films, and industrial laminates. Other types of metallized films cater to specific requirements, such as high-temperature resistance, chemical resistance, or decorative finishes, addressing a wide range of end-user needs across diverse industries.

- Competition from Alternative Packaging Materials- Competition from alternative packaging materials presents a significant challenge for the metallized film market, compelling manufacturers to innovate and differentiate their products to remain competitive. One notable alternative is biodegradable and compostable packaging materials, which are gaining traction due to increasing environmental concerns and regulatory pressures to reduce plastic waste. Bioplastics, derived from renewable sources such as corn starch or sugarcane, offer comparable barrier properties to metallized films while addressing sustainability concerns. As consumer awareness of environmental issues grows, there is a rising preference for eco-friendly packaging solutions, posing a competitive threat to traditional metallized films. Moreover, advancements in material science have led to the development of novel packaging materials with enhanced barrier properties and functionality, challenging the dominance of metallized films in certain applications.
For instance, nano-coatings and barrier coatings applied to paper and board substrates offer improved moisture resistance and barrier performance, providing viable alternatives to metallized films in packaging applications where sustainability and recyclability are paramount. Additionally, flexible packaging innovations such as high-performance multilayer structures and modified atmosphere packaging (MAP) systems are increasingly utilized to extend shelf life and maintain product freshness, posing competition to metallized films. To address the challenge of competition from alternative packaging materials, metallized film manufacturers are investing in research and development to enhance their product offerings, improve sustainability profiles, and meet evolving market demands.
